#edb672 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#edb672 is composed of 92.9% red, 71.4% green and 44.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 23.2% magenta, 51.9% yellow and 7.1% black. It has a hue angle of 33.2 degrees, a saturation of 77.4% and a lightness of 68.8%. #edb672 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ffe4 with #db6d00.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c66.

Shades and Tints of #edb672

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#100902 is the darkest color, while #fffef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#edb672

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b0b0af is the less saturated color, while #f9b766 is the most saturated one.
